This article addresses the post-entry performance of Portuguese firms, using survival and hazard functions, along a period of eighteen years, from 1985 to 2007. The method follows the “Manual on Business Demography Statistics” (OECD/Eurostat, 2007), so as to assure international comparability with other datasets, such those from the Entrepreneurship Indicators Programme (OECD/Eurostat 2008 and 2009). In the exercise, we use a sub-set of the Quadros de Pessoal dataset (Employment Administrative Records by the Portuguese Ministry of Labour and Social Security), where only active employer enterprises are considered. The survival analysis is then disaggregated in different dimensions, namely sectors, regions and size class.
